TICKET-982: DeployBuddy bot posting to wrong channel due to misconfigured env. Reviewer note: the bot's staging env file was missing the channel override and reused production settings, so status messages leaked into the main room. This change splits the env templates per environment and adds validation at startup. Please confirm the new staging file sets BOT_CHANNEL and POLL_INTERVAL as shown in the diff. The last required entry is the line that authenticates the bot against the deploy-status API:

vault entry, bagep-yahip: VAULT_KEY8=d2a227e5

Subject: Quickstore 4.2 — bloom filter now fronts the KV layer

Plugin authors: starting with this release, Quickstore places a bloom filter ahead of the key-value store. Negative lookups return faster; false positives fall through safely. No API changes are required on your side. Verify your plugin against the staging build referenced below.

session token of fahif-tadup = htk3_9c7

Quick note for the new contractor: pagination on the Mossgate public REST API is cursor-based, not offset-based. Clients pass the cursor from the previous response; never construct one by hand. Cursors are signed server-side so tampered ones get rejected with a 400. The signing happens in the API gateway, which reads its key from the env file. That key sits on the line directly below:

sealed setting: COURIER_KEY29=170ad45524657711572101e080d15